Northumbria Police Mounted Section meet our Mini Police

21st April 2023Shelley Metcalfe

The Marine Park Mini Police were delighted to meet Prince and Parker, Northumbria Police’s two noble Police Horses. The treat was a kind gesture from Northumbria Police, in recognition of the children’s commitment to the Mini Police Project.

The children were fascinated to learn that all the police horses in Northumbria have a name which begins with ‘P.’ Something which is a long standing tradition. Prince (the brown one!) was named in honour of The Duke of Edinburgh, Prince Philip following his passing. They were intrigued to learn that Parker (the white one!) was selected to escort the late Queen Elizabeth II as she was carried to Windsor as part of her funeral procession.

The horses and their officers gave the children a demonstration of some of the techniques they can use to control crowds. They also gave the children an insight in to the day to day life of a Police Horse and the specialist skills that they can draw upon, including their senses and their ability to assess risk and danger.

It was a wonderful opportunity for all!!

Y3 Local Democracy in Action

22nd March 2023Stuart McVittie-Mathews

Today, three children from Year 3 were selected to represent the school at South Tyneside Council’s “Staryland” event, which was designed to explore the ideas that underpin democracy in fun and creative ways.

First, the class worked with children from other schools to learn the history of “Staryland” and decide on a list of qualities that make a good leader. Then, the children heard the candidates give a speech explaining why they would be the best person to elect as leader.

Children then voted to elect their chosen leader. After the event, the children met the Mayor of South Tyneside and other council officials. Overall, a great trip to show children democracy in action!
